Output dfeb1cb17214641d0afdd4bf52f173e2de7ac0059dff046afa4bce44092b81cf:1

value
4400809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08e405ec2c71b97366ab1609ca7c0bc9660cf88d OP_EQUAL
address
32W2VQMrUNSUVkHm4HUSeiv1VssvR1Dqui
transaction
dfeb1cb17214641d0afdd4bf52f173e2de7ac0059dff046afa4bce44092b81cf
confirmations
468304
spent
true